6 writes to EnableSensitiveData
Aspire.Azure.AI.Inference (1)
AspireAzureAIInferenceExtensions.cs (1)
224
EnableSensitiveData
= builder.EnableSensitiveTelemetryData
Aspire.OpenAI (1)
AspireOpenAIClientBuilderChatClientExtensions.cs (1)
78
EnableSensitiveData
= builder.EnableSensitiveTelemetryData
Microsoft.Extensions.AI.Tests (4)
ChatCompletion\FunctionInvokingChatClientTests.cs (1)
679
new FunctionInvokingChatClient(new OpenTelemetryChatClient(c, sourceName: sourceName) {
EnableSensitiveData
= enableSensitiveData }));
ChatCompletion\OpenTelemetryChatClientTests.cs (3)
100
instance.
EnableSensitiveData
= enableSensitiveData;
384
instance.
EnableSensitiveData
= true;
545
instance.
EnableSensitiveData
= true;
5 references to EnableSensitiveData
Microsoft.Extensions.AI (5)
ChatCompletion\FunctionInvokingChatClient.cs (1)
1136
bool enableSensitiveData = activity is { IsAllDataRequested: true } && InnerClient.GetService<OpenTelemetryChatClient>()?.
EnableSensitiveData
is true;
ChatCompletion\OpenTelemetryChatClient.cs (4)
454
if (
EnableSensitiveData
)
571
if (
EnableSensitiveData
&& response.AdditionalProperties is { } props)
607
if (
EnableSensitiveData
&& activity is { IsAllDataRequested: true })
624
if (
EnableSensitiveData
&& activity is { IsAllDataRequested: true })